Tom H. Kelosky, 84

Mr. Tom H. Kelosky, 84, of Fombell passed away on Sunday, March 15th, 2026 at his residence.

Tom was born in West Homestead, Pa on April 22nd, 1941 to the late Rudy and Betty (Patton) Kelosky. He enlisted with the United States Army Airborne on October 26th, 1958 and served until his honorable discharge on February 19th, 1962 with the rank of Private First Class, and was awarded the Parachutist Badge. Following his military service, Tom worked for the Steamfitter’s Local Union 47 until his retirement. He is a member of the Lillyville Church of God and Air Fitness. In his younger years Tom enjoyed hunting, fishing, and riding his Can-Am.

He is survived by his wife, Kay (Nesbitt) Kelosky whom he married on April 19th, 2008, sons and daughters-in-law, Terry and Lisa Kelosky, Troy and Kristen Kelosky, Ted and Linda Kelosky, step-daughters and their spouses, Linda and Kevin Tomon, Tammy and Mark Pitchford, and Donna and Bob Varga all of Fombell, 10 grandchildren and numerous great-grandchildren. He is also survived by his sisters, Vicki (Ron) Butch of North Sewickley Township and Mary Pletz-Benedict of Sewickley, and his brothers, Rudy (Kathy) Kelosky of Franklin Township and Mike (Emily) Kelosky of North Sewickley Township.

Tom was preceded in death by his parents, his first wife Anna M. (Bellion) Kelosky whom he married on September 22nd, 1962 and passed away on February 6th, 2005, son, Todd Kelosky, grandson, Joseph “Jojo” Kelosky, sisters, Minnie Lutz and Patty Myers, and brothers, Ray Kelosky and Roger Kelosky.
